function validate() {

var string2 = document.frmMember.fname.value;

if (!string2) { 
 alert ("Please enter your name!"); 
return false;
}

var iChars = "*|,\":<>[]{}`';()&$#%£-/";
for (var i = 0; i < string2.length; i++) {
if (iChars.indexOf(string2.charAt(i)) != -1){
 alert (string2 + " contains illegal characters!"); 
 document.frmMember.fname.focus(); 
return false;
}
} 

var string = document.frmMember.fuser.value;

if (!string) { 
 alert ("Please enter your username!"); 
return false;
}

var iChars = "*|,\":<>[]{}`';()&$#%£-/";
for (var i = 0; i < string.length; i++) {
if (iChars.indexOf(string.charAt(i)) != -1){
 alert (string + " contains illegal characters!"); 
 document.frmMember.fuser.focus(); 
return false;
}
}

var string3 = document.frmMember.fpass.value;

if (!string3) { 
 alert ("Please enter your password!"); 
return false;
}

var iChars = "*|,\":<>[]{}`';()&$#%£-/";
for (var i = 0; i < string3.length; i++) {
if (iChars.indexOf(string3.charAt(i)) != -1){
 alert (string3 + " contains illegal characters!"); 
 document.frmMember.fpass.focus(); 
return false;
}
}
	
return true;

}
